sämpylöitä
Sämpylöitä, commonly known as Finnish bread rolls, are a staple in Finnish baking. These small, soft loaves are typically made from wheat flour, yeast, water or milk, and a touch of sugar and salt. Their texture is characterized by a slightly crisp crust and a fluffy, airy interior.
